The Picture Archiving and Communication System: a useful tool in a case of upper oesophageal foreign body
G Kulamarva1, J R Buckland, S Sapare
1Department of ENT & Head Neck Surgery, Queen Alexandra Hospital, Portsmouth, UK.
Abstract:
We present a case of an oesophageal foreign body (approximately 2x2 cm) which was not seen on the initial lateral soft tissue neck X-ray but was detected following manipulation of the X-ray using the Picture Archiving and Communication System of X-ray viewing. This system gives the user much greater flexibility, including a choice of magnification and contrast.
